What it is

A closer look at Sweet Potato Glass Noodles.

Korean glass noodles made from sweet potato starch, used in japchae and soups, chewy and translucent when cooked.

What to look for

Know it when you find it.

A chewy, elastic texture when cooked, a translucent appearance, and good quality starch that doesn't break easily.
